EV fleet startup TOCAL raises Rs 9 crore in funding led by XB Group, other investors


TOCAL, a technology-led EV fleet and achievement infrastructure startup, has secured funding commitments of Rs 9 crore after showing on Startup Singam, the startup actuality present airing on Star Vijay and streaming on JioHotstar.

The funding was led by XB Group, the mum or dad group of Okay-Indev Logistics, with a dedication of Rs 8.5 crore. The spherical additionally noticed participation from Navyug International Ventures, a household workplace, and Ms. Nivetha Muralidharan, an HNI investor.

The funding additionally marks the start of a strategic collaboration between TOCAL and Okay-Indev Logistics to construct an built-in logistics platform that mixes EV-powered last-mile supply, fulfilment infrastructure and nationwide logistics capabilities.

Based by Dhairyasheel Deshmukh, TOCAL presently operates in Bengaluru, enabling sustainable logistics by technology-enabled EV fleet operations and last-mile supply companies for e-commerce, fast commerce and direct-to-consumer (D2C) manufacturers.

The startup combines EV-powered supply companies, fulfilment centres, fleet administration software program, and rider enablement right into a single ecosystem. TOCAL stated this approachenables manufacturers to simplify their provide chain operations whereas bettering effectivity, scalability, and sustainability.

Commenting on the funding, Dhairyasheel Deshmukh, Founder & CEO, TOCAL, stated, “This funding reinforces our conviction that India’s commerce ecosystem requires greater than electrical transportation; it requires trendy, technology-driven logistics infrastructure. Our imaginative and prescient is to construct the working spine that allows manufacturers to retailer, fulfil and ship merchandise sooner and in probably the most sustainable means. Along with Okay-Indev Logistics, we’re creating an built-in platform that mixes fulfilment by strategically situated micro-warehouses with a tech-enabled EV fleet to help the subsequent part of India’s commerce progress.”

As a part of the partnership, Okay-Indev Logistics will contribute its experience in micro-warehousing, nationwide logistics operations and enterprise relationships, whereas TOCAL will strengthen the platform by its EV fleet operations, hyperlocal supply capabilities, driver community and proprietary expertise.

The startup will use the raised capital to develop its operations past Bengaluru into main metropolitan cities, set up strategically situated achievement facilities, scale TOCAL’s EV fleet and operational infrastructure, improve its fleet, warehouse, and order administration expertise, and strengthen enterprise gross sales and strategic partnerships.

Over the subsequent 4 to 5 years, TOCAL goals to develop to greater than 15 cities, deploy over 20,000 electrical autos, function 75 fulfilment centres, and associate with over 1,000 manufacturers.
